Do I typically need a referral to see Dr. Jerry Sadler as my Family Physician, or to see a specialist?
Generally, you do not need a referral to see Dr. Jerry Sadler to establish care as your Family Physician/Primary Care Physician (PCP), provided he is accepting new patients. However, to see most medical specialists (e.g., cardiologist, dermatologist), Dr. Jerry Sadler will typically provide a referral after an assessment. Many insurance plans, particularly HMOs (Health Maintenance Organizations), *do require* a referral from your designated PCP (Dr. Jerry Sadler, if so chosen) for specialist visits to be covered. PPO (Preferred Provider Organization) plans may offer more flexibility for self-referral to specialists, but this might result in higher out-of-pocket costs if the specialist is out-of-network or if a referral would have secured better coverage. Always check your specific insurance plan's referral requirements.
What is 'continuity of care' and why is it important with a Family Physician like Dr. Jerry Sadler?
Continuity of care refers to the process where your Family Physician, Dr. Jerry Sadler, sees you for your health needs on an ongoing basis, rather than seeing different doctors for different issues. This consistency is valuable because Dr. Jerry Sadler becomes familiar with your medical background, your lifestyle, and what's 'normal' for you. This knowledge aids in quicker diagnosis, more effective treatment plans, better chronic disease management, and ensures that your care is well-coordinated, especially important when dealing with multiple specialists or navigating complex insurance plans. It's about having a trusted healthcare partner throughout your life who understands your complete health picture.

Can you explain common health insurance terms like co-pays, deductibles, and co-insurance?
A co-pay (or copayment) is a fixed amount you pay for a covered healthcare service at the time of service. Your insurance plan pays the rest of the allowed amount. A deductible is the amount you must pay out-of-pocket for covered healthcare services *before* your insurance plan starts to pay its share. Preventive services are often covered before meeting the deductible. Co-insurance is your share of the costs of a covered healthcare service, calculated as a percentage (e.g., 20%) of the allowed amount for the service, which you pay *after* you've met your deductible. These amounts and how they apply vary greatly by insurance plan. Consult your insurance plan documents or contact your insurer's member services for details.
